The SI7136DP-T1-GE3 is a logic-level N-Channel MOSFET (Metal Oxide Semiconductor Field Effect Transistor). As a member of the SI7 Series of Gold Power MOSFETS, it is designed to offer enhanced performance in small board-space applications. This power MOSFET is optimized and designed for use in power management applications with low gate threshold, low on-state resistance, and thermal management capability, as well as long-term business and product reliability and stability. In addition, it has dynamic performance in medium to low power applications.
Application field
The SI7136DP-T1-GE3 is most commonly used for medium to low power switching applications. It can be used as a switch for a wide range of applications. For example, it can be used for a range of AC and DC motor control applications in automotive, industrial, and home appliances. It can also be used for remote power switching and control. Other applications in which this MOSFET is commonly used are speed controls, toys, over-current protection, and battery life management.
